GeForce GTX 260M SLI has 172% more power consumption, than Radeon RX 560 mobile.
Radeon RX 560 mobile has 2 GB more memory, than GeForce GTX 260M SLI.
Both cards are used in Laptops.
GeForce GTX 260M SLI is build with G9x architecture, and Radeon RX 560 mobile - with Polaris.
Core clock speed of Radeon RX 560 mobile is 625 MHz higher, than GeForce GTX 260M SLI.
GeForce GTX 260M SLI is manufactured by 55 nm process technology, and Radeon RX 560 mobile - by 14 nm process technology.
Memory clock speed of Radeon RX 560 mobile is 5050 MHz higher, than GeForce GTX 260M SLI.
